This antique child's stroller was manufactured by the C.E.M. CO. in Geneva, Illinois, and features a unique 1910 patented pivoting backrest design. The cart consists of a black metal frame on iron spoke wheels with a long wooden push-pull handle and two-way steps. The wooden handle is stamped in black ink reading C E M Co Geneva IL U.S.A. 57 inches long by 18 inches wide. This piece presents in well-loved antique condition, showing character-rich oxidation to the iron wheels and metal bracing. The wood and original upholstery exhibit a weathered patina consistent with age. Denting to metal wheel covers.
